← back
Google Workspace Cold Email Management Script Needed

Google Workspace Cold Email Management Script Needed

Pending
💰 USD 30–250 👤 Unknown 🕒 22d ago status: new
Python MySQL Node.js Email Marketing PostgreSQL Compliance SQLite SMTP B2B Marketing API Integration
I’m looking for a developer to build a compliant cold email management script for Google Workspace. The tool should help manage legitimate B2B outreach campaigns while respecting Google Workspace limits and email compliance rules. Main features needed: Create and manage Google Workspace users using the official Google Admin SDK Import leads from CSV files Connect approved Google Workspace sender accounts Configure SMTP or Gmail API sending for each authorized account Set safe daily sending limits per sender Add delays between emails Schedule campaigns by day and time Personalize templates using variables like {{first_name}}, {{company}}, {{country}} Track sent emails, failed emails, replies, bounces, and unsubscribes Automatically stop sending to bounced or unsubscribed contacts Prevent duplicate contacts from being emailed twice Export sending reports Provide campaign logs Store credentials securely Include clear setup documentation Important requirements: The system must respect Google Workspace sending limits The system must not bypass Google limits or abuse account rotation Every campaign must include an unsubscribe option The tool must support bounce and complaint suppression The tool is for legitimate B2B outreach only Preferred technology: Python or Node.js Google Admin SDK Gmail API or SMTP integration SQLite / PostgreSQL / MySQL Simple dashboard or CLI Secure environment variable configuration Please apply only if you have experience with Google Workspace APIs, email deliverability, SMTP/Gmail API integration, and compliant cold email automation. I need a script that works like a lightweight cold email platform connected to Google Workspace. The script should allow me to: Create/manage Workspace users via Admin SDK Add approved sender accounts Upload leads by CSV Create personalized cold email campaigns Send emails with safe limits per account Distribute sending between authorized users without exceeding Google limits Track sent, failed, bounced, replied, and unsubscribed contacts Stop sending automatically to unsubscribed or bounced emails Export reports Provide full setup instructions This must be built for compliant B2B outreach, not for spam or bypassing Google restrictions
↗ View on Freelancer